@gajop
Ah, I didn't realise Atlas is ambiguous.
Yes, the arm t1 air transport is called Atlas
(It's 2nd one from the right, in the back row, btw. The 'round' one is the Dragonfly.)
But... Atlas is also a term for a single image file witch features multipe, or all, 2D art (sprites or textures) of a project or game.
For BAR this means all units of a faction use parts of the same very big texture. (example of atlas)
hope that cleared stuff up
